Only one week ago, Savi finished her NAJ (Novice Agility Jumpers with Weaves title) with a 1st place, and was bumped up the next day to compete in Open and won the class. Well this past weekend at the Scottish Terrier Club of New England trial, Savi did it again and qualified in Open Jumpers for her 2nd OAJ (Open Agility Jumpers) leg with a 2nd place! It takes three qualifying legs to earn the title.
On Saturday, it took Savi time to acclimate to the new venue and she just got better and better with each run. On Sunday, Savi had a terrific Open Standard run but her handler, me, accidentally sent her to an off course jump, and since we are working on keeping her attitude up and trying to build speed, I just went on, not letting her know a mistake was made, and she did a super job which is more important than qualifying and possibly taking a backward step in our training. Her Open Jumpers run, shown below, was smooth and she handled beautifully. She isn't running as fast as I would like but she is not experienced and the confidence and speed will come. Very proud of how well she did and look forward to our next trial in a few weeks.

Sister Jam ran well but with some handler errors (oops) but managed to Q (qualify) in Masters Jumpers for her 2nd MXJ leg with a 4th place! It takes ten qualifying runs to earn the AKC MX (Master Standard) or MXJ (Master Jumpers) title. Masters is the highest level of AKC agility and the course are the most complex and to earn a Q, you must have a perfect run (no faults) with a score of 100.

Mia-belle earns her Open Agility Jumpers Title!
Mia-belle is now CH Grayhart's Special Request, CDX, RA, JH, OA, OAJ, NSD, RD, VX2
I am thrilled to announce Mia earned her 3rd OAJ (open agility jumpers leg) and OAJ title with a first place at the Charlotte Dog Training Club Agility Trial in Concord, NC. She also earned her first excellent jumpers leg with a first place! We came very close to qualifying on our other runs but Miss Mia is really fast and her handler (me) had some errors that pulled her off jumps. At the excellent level, no mistakes are allowed which can be difficult when running a fast dog with a lot of drive. I have to cue Mia right on time: a second too early, and I pull her off course; a second too late and she's off to run her own course :) Even though we had some mistakes, we also had a ton of fun and I can't wait to do it again! New OAJ title for Sky!
Congratulations to Debbie and Sky for earning her Open Jumpers with Weaves (OAJ) title! Not only did Sky finish her title in style with a 2nd place but she then went on to "double Q", meaning to earn two qualifying legs in the same day! Sky had a clean run in Open Standard for her 2nd leg and won the class - another 1st place for Sky!
Sky is now, CH Grayhart Lightfoot Early Morning Rain, RN, JH, TD, NA, OAJ, NSD, NRD, CGC, VX
